What Is A Lactic Acid Blood Draw For. Treatment depends on the underlying cause and other factors, such as disease severity. Your lactic acid level is high if it is between 2 and 4 mmol/l. Most of it is made. Lactic acid, also known as lactate, is a substance the body produces mainly by the breakdown of glucose under anaerobic conditions (i.e., without oxygen), like anaerobic. Your body makes lactic acid to fuel cells when they’re working harder than usual. A lactic acid test is a blood test that measures the level of lactic acid made in the body. Most of it is made by muscle tissue and red blood cells. Regarding a diagnosis, lactic acidosis requires blood tests that measure the lactate level and evaluate for acidity in the bloodstream. Blood is drawn from a vein (venipuncture), usually from the inside of the elbow or the back of the hand. A lactic acid (also called lactate) test is a blood test that measures the level of lactic acid made in the body. A test can be done to measure the amount of lactic acid in the blood.
